Each problem has a concrete product response. Results support human decisions; they never replace job analysis, interviews, or official qualification rules.
Problem 1
Series exploration overload
Problem. Thousands of OPM series and vacancy postings overwhelm applicants.
Solution. Federal Fit maps a 50-question profile to occupational families and illustrative series for research — not a qualification determination.
Problem 2
Résumé keyword games
Problem. Federal résumés optimized for keywords still miss role demands.
Solution. Pair vacancy specialized experience with domain strengths and honest gap notes.
Problem 3
Hiring path confusion
Problem. Competitive, excepted, Pathways, and internal paths look identical to outsiders.
Solution. Federal Edition links to official USAJOBS/OPM resources with last-reviewed dates and plain-language path prompts.
